Output 8c409f3a6066591bab669633a9c0bb9655d5d7fe85f50d89752534785214e930:6

value
42405021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6754669a68798a2d96457009bb615c9580fe38ce OP_EQUAL
address
3B7Nda9F6m4PLQb7MuxLhNvKAozresfmyB
transaction
8c409f3a6066591bab669633a9c0bb9655d5d7fe85f50d89752534785214e930
spent
true